§ 29-5-108 — Liability of requesting jurisdiction

Text
(1)During the time that a
police officer or deputy sheriff, as applicable, of a town, city, city and county,
county, or of a state institution of higher education employing a peace officer in
accordance with article 7.5 of title 24 is assigned to temporary duty within the
jurisdiction of another town, city, city and county, county, or of another state
institution of higher education employing a peace officer in accordance with article
7.5 of title 24, as provided in sections 29-5-103, 29-5-104, and 29-5-106, any
liability that accrues under the provisions of article 10 of title 24, on account of the
negligent or otherwise tortious act of the police officer or deputy sheriff while
performing the duty is imposed upon the requesting town, city, city and county,
